In music, texture is how the tempo, melody melodic, and harmony harmonic materials are combined in a musical composition, determining the overall quality of the sound in a piece. Texture describes how layers of sound within a piece of music interact. Imagine that a piece of spaghetti is a melody line. One strand of spaghetti by itself is a single melody, as in a monophonic texture. ... This would be similar to a homophonic texture.
